Merge "Chore: Automation adds modeling-yang-kit.yaml"
[ci-management.git] / jjb / ccsdk / ccsdk-csit.yaml
index 5f3b2cd..3c7d09a 100644 (file)
@@ -2,46 +2,68 @@
 - project:
     name: ccsdk-distribution-csit
     jobs:
-      - '{project-name}-review-verification-maven-{stream}':
-          build-node: ubuntu1804-docker-8c-8g
-          container-public-registry: 'nexus3.onap.org:10001'
-          container-snapshot-registry: 'nexus3.onap.org:10003'
-          mvn-params: '-Dmaven.test.skip=true -Ddocker.skip.push=true -P docker'
+      - "{project-name}-review-verification-maven-{stream}":
+          mvn-params: "-Dmaven.test.skip=true -Ddocker.skip.push=true -Pdocker"
           maven-versions-plugin: true
-      - '{project-name}-merge-verification-maven-{stream}':
-          build-node: ubuntu1804-docker-8c-8g
-          container-public-registry: 'nexus3.onap.org:10001'
-          container-snapshot-registry: 'nexus3.onap.org:10003'
-          mvn-params: '-Dmaven.test.skip=true -Ddocker.skip.push=true -P docker'
+      - "{project-name}-merge-verification-maven-{stream}":
+          mvn-params: "-Dmaven.test.skip=true -Ddocker.skip.push=true -Pdocker"
           maven-versions-plugin: true
+    project-name: "ccsdk-distribution"
+    recipients: "dtimoney@att.com"
+    # project name in gerrit
+    project: "ccsdk/distribution"
+    stream:
+      - "master":
+          branch: "master"
+      - "montreal":
+          branch: "montreal"
+      - "london":
+          branch: "london"
+      - "kohn":
+          branch: "kohn"
+    mvn-settings: "ccsdk-distribution-settings"
+    mvn-version: "mvn38"
+    robot-options: ""
+    branch: "master"
 
-    project-name: 'ccsdk-distribution'
-    recipients: 'dtimoney@att.com'
+- project:
+    name: ccsdk-oran-csit-java11
+    jobs:
+      - "{project-name}-review-verification-maven-{stream}":
+          mvn-params: "-Dmaven.test.skip=true -Ddocker.skip.push=true -Pdocker"
+      - "{project-name}-merge-verification-maven-{stream}":
+          mvn-params: "-Dmaven.test.skip=true -Ddocker.skip.push=true -Pdocker"
+    project-name: "ccsdk-oran"
+    recipients: "bjorn.magnusson@est.tech martin.c.yan@est.tech"
     # project name in gerrit
-    project: 'ccsdk/distribution'
+    project: "ccsdk/oran"
     stream:
-      - 'master':
-          branch: 'master'
+      - "kohn":
+          branch: "kohn"
     java-version: openjdk11
-    mvn-version: 'mvn36'
-    mvn-settings: 'ccsdk-distribution-settings'
-    mvn-global-settings: global-settings
-    robot-options: ''
-    branch: 'master'
+    mvn-settings: "ccsdk-oran-settings"
+    mvn-version: "mvn38"
+    robot-options: ""
+    branch: "master"
 
 - project:
-    name: ccsdk-oran-csit
+    name: ccsdk-oran-csit-java17
     jobs:
-      - '{project-name}-{stream}-verify-csit-{functionality}'
-      - '{project-name}-{stream}-csit-{functionality}'
-    project-name: 'ccsdk-oran'
-    recipients: 'bjorn.magnusson@est.tech maxime.bonneau@est.tech'
+      - "{project-name}-review-verification-maven-{stream}":
+          mvn-params: "-Dmaven.test.skip=true -Ddocker.skip.push=true -Pdocker"
+      - "{project-name}-merge-verification-maven-{stream}":
+          mvn-params: "-Dmaven.test.skip=true -Ddocker.skip.push=true -Pdocker"
+    project-name: "ccsdk-oran"
+    recipients: "bjorn.magnusson@est.tech martin.c.yan@est.tech"
+    # project name in gerrit
+    project: "ccsdk/oran"
     stream:
-      - 'master':
-          branch: 'master'
-      - 'guilin':
-          branch: 'guilin'
-    functionality:
-      - 'polmansuite':
-          trigger_jobs: '{project-name}-maven-merge-{stream}'
-    robot-options: ''
+      - "master":
+          branch: "master"
+      - "london":
+          branch: "london"
+    java-version: openjdk17
+    mvn-settings: "ccsdk-oran-settings"
+    mvn-version: "mvn38"
+    robot-options: ""
+    branch: "master"